Carol Creighton Burnett is an American actress, comedienne, singer, dancer and writer. Burnett started her career in New York. After becoming a hit on Broadway, she debuted on television.

Other Facts

She has been nominated for two Tony Awards and was a recipient of a 1969 Special Award (along with Leonard Bernstein and Rex Harrison). Both her parents were alcoholics, and after their marriage ended Burnett was raised by her maternal grandmother, Mabel Eudora White.

Who is the old lady in Carol Burnett show?

Thelma Harper, better known as Mama, is a fictional character played by American actress Vicki Lawrence. Mama is a purse-lipped, thickset senior citizen in her mid-to-late 60s.

Who was the handsome actor on The Carol Burnett Show?

Lyle Waggoner's TV debut came in a 1966 episode of Gunsmoke called "Wishbone." A year later, he got the job of announcer and sketch actor on The Carol Burnett Show. His good looks soon won him millions of fans around the country.
